Job description


  • Orient and instruct new drivers regarding their job duties and assist supervisor in assigning and directing the work of employees.

  • Communicate with supervisor or manager to assure proper flow of vehicles and maintain log of stock numbers for each vehicle moved and its lot location.

  • Communicate schedules and assignments to the crew members.

  • Serve as lane leader on sale days

  • Coordinate move requirements with lot manager and quadrant coordinator.

  • Assist supervisor in making sure that lease lanes and pre-sales are properly staged and parked.

  • Manage vans and transporting drivers to locations.

  • Ensure timely pick-up and drop-off of employees and vehicles by transporting them according to schedule to their proper work destinations.

  • Shuttle employees to and from auxiliary parking lots on sale days; provide transportation to employees parking inventoried vehicles at remote sites.

  • Pick-up and drop-off employees and other Auction personnel to/from the Auction, parking lots, dealerships, customer locations/businesses, and other locations.

  • Perform daily maintenance and routine checks of the van and clean and service the vehicle with fuel, lubricants, and accessories.

  • Visibly demonstrate safety commitment by following all safety and health procedures and modeling the behaviors related to such.

  • Work in cooperation with Market Safety Manager in support of all safety activities aligned with Safety Excellence.

  • Work with manager to review work volumes, plan and continuously monitor staffing levels to ensure efficiency, quality work product, and effective customer service; review departmental performance against key performance indicators and metrics and develop and execute strategies for improvement.

  • Effectively leads the team at the location by setting an example in behavior, championing Cox/Manheim values and ensuring that all employees are treated with respect.

  • Enforce all company policies and procedures related to employee and customer conduct.

  • Perform other duties as assigned by management. May be required to work overtime as business needs dictate.

Minimum Qualifications


  • High School Diploma/GED and 3 years' experience in a related field.

  • OR the right candidate could also have a different combination, such as any level degree/certification beyond a HS diploma/GED in a related discipline; OR 5 years' experience.

  • Safe Drivers needed; Valid driver's license required.


Preferred Qualifications


  • Basic mechanical knowledge of identifying (i.e., flat tires, low gas, jump starting vehicles).

  • Knowledge of lot operations/lot layout preferred.

  • Knowledge of LDM preferred.

  • Required to stand, walk, reach, talk and hear, vision abilities required to include close, distance and color vision, depth perception and ability to adjust focus.

  • Ability to stand for prolonged periods of time.

  • Ability to lift 1-15 pounds.


USD 18.17 - 27.21 per hour


Compensation

Hourly pay rate is in the range of $18.17 - $27.21/hour. The hourly base rate may vary within the anticipated range based on factors such as the ultimate location of the position and the selected candidate's knowledge, skills, and abilities. Position may be eligible for additional compensation that may include commission (annual, monthly, etc.) and/or an incentive program.


Benefits

Employees are eligible to receive a minimum of sixteen hours of paid time off every month and seven paid holidays throughout the calendar year. Employees are also eligible for additional paid time off in the form of bereavement leave, time off to vote, jury duty leave, volunteer time off, military leave, and parental leave.
